KAPELLEN
Province : Antwerpen
![]()
Origin/meaning : The arms are derived from the arms of Ekeren. Kapellen belonged to Ekeren until 1801. Behind the shield stands St. James, the patron saint of the town. He holds in his hand a small church, symbolising the Hoogenschoot chapel in the municipality. Literature : Anonymous : Van evers en heiligen - wapens en vlaggen van de gemeenten in de provincie Antwerpen. Antwerpen, 1998. Gemeentegids Kapellen. |
